Essentially, the EFM32GG11 Datasheet acts as a user manual for the microcontroller. It's structured to provide clear and precise information, ensuring that developers can make informed decisions during the design and implementation phases. Within its pages, you'll find:
- Detailed pin assignments and their functions.
- Specifications for integrated peripherals like UART, SPI, I2C, and ADC.
- Information on clocking structures and timing diagrams.
- Guidance on power modes and energy efficiency.
- Electrical characteristics, including voltage and current ratings.
